  10. Bobby, the RIA's are absolutely entry level 1911's, what makes them entry level is the amazing price point. What makes their price point amazing, is the great quality of the pistol for what you pay. The fancy finish isnt there, and some little things need addresses in my opinion, but the are a fantastic pistol, that functions well...amazingly well when you factor in their cost. This is from my first hand experience, as I have owned 2 RIA 1911's, Charles Daly EMS 1911, A Kimber Custom 2, A Taurus PT 1911, and a Norinco. Not to mention, In addition to owning all of the above at one time or another, I have also shot Les Bear, Wilson, Nighthawk and Christensen 1911's. So, in my unofficial opinion, I'd venture to say I can speak with a little authority on the subject.The Rocks were, by far, my favorite of the bunch.

    BTW, the Mosins are fun as shit to shoot. Plus if you want to learn about things like barrel shortening and doing a re-crown on it, big dieal, its a 100 dollar gun. I gave mine a once over, milled off the bolt, bent up a custom longer one and welded it on, gave it a "homebrew" trigger job that smoothed it out and added a spring to take all the loose slack out of the trigger when its cocked. Refinished the stock, and threw a cheap optic on the dove tail where the original rear sight was, scout rifle style All pretty much free or cheap...

    If you have the cash go for it, I am impressed with the limited time Ive had saiga products in my hands, especially when you factor in the cost. Which "Tactical" model 10/22 are you eyeing? the standard tactical, or the Target tactical, the reg tactical model is nothing to write home about, just a blued carbine with a synthetic stock and a mini-14 muzzle break.. the target tactical on the other hand, is a mucho nicer rifle..16inch bull barrel, hogue overmold stock, bipod... I wouldve bought one of those in a heart beat, but there are none to be found local, this standard target model I scored is a great option to look into as well.. 20 inch hammer forged stainless bull barrel, laminated stock, better than the regular trigger, polished bolt, much nicer fit and finsh than the regular 10/22 carbine I have. Much.

    This is a Rock Island MAP1, which is the exact same gun as a Tanfoglio/EAA witness...or if you want, a CZ75 clone, in 9mm.

    Great feel to it, easy to shoot well and fast. Fun range toy with the 30rd mags I ordered. Got it "used" but it looked like it had never seen more then a couple mags at most... Runs like a top.

    MAP1.jpg

    Next up, Taurus PT1911... Now all you 1911 guys, this will really bunch your panties..it is also a 9mm. Dont hate... I have had 'em in .38super and .45acp too(still have).... I dont reload so the .38 super was pricey to shoot, the .45 is for killing people, and this one is for my race series, 9mm out of a full size 1911 is sooooooo easy to be accurate and fast with for me. Hardly any noticeable recoil and follow ups come oh-so quick. Already gave it a trigger job, and polished the rails up, and took a little out of the spring for the grip safety to soften it up more.. gun is tight, smooth, and damned accurate for its price. Already ran 400 thru it for "break in", only one FTE, on the 12 rd fired, nothing else after.
